Ticket: Sealed vault — Gatewick turnstile counter

The Gatewick counter service at Pellam Stadium stores its API credentials in the Stonebox vault. After last night's power cut, Stonebox resealed itself and attendance counts stopped syncing. New team members: this is expected behavior, not data loss. Follow the reseal checklist, then restore access using the recovery passphrase below.

recovery phrase for kajop-yagef: istael-ulaius

- [ ] **Loading dock briefing (night shift).** Walk the new starter through the Calder Street dock before 23:00. Deliveries are accepted 22:00–05:30 only; anything outside that window gets turned away and logged. Couriers buzz the dock intercom; verify the delivery reference against the night manifest before lifting the shutter. Pallets stay inside the yellow line until scanned. The shutter control panel is keypad-locked after each use — new starters should memorise, not write down, the dock code below.

staff pass of yafof-baweg = bdg-OLNEG-5

## Local Setup

Portionly scales recipes via the `scaler-core` service. You need Node 20 and the Fennel CLI.

1. Clone the repo and run `fennel install`.
2. Copy `env.sample` to `.env.local`.
3. Run migrations with `fennel db up`.
4. Start with `fennel dev` — hot reload is on by default.

Unit conversions live in `tables/units.yml`; don't edit generated files. The local database must be reachable before step 3. Use the connection string below.

primary connection of yagep-kahip = redis://giliel_svc:zYiKsLL2PLpfPL@db-348f.xolmarsys.corp:5432/fenwyn

**Onboarding: Health Checks Behind the Larkspan Balancer**

Each app node behind the Larkspan load balancer answers a health probe every ten seconds; two consecutive failures pull the node from rotation. Deploys must pass the probe before traffic shifts. To push builds to the probe-gated environment, you'll need the deploy key shown below.

deploy key for kajof-fajop: bky6_gDHw9Q